2012 Fall TV Schedule: Tuesday Night Line-Up

It’s Monday and that means it’s time for Tuesday’s 2012 – 2013 Fall TV Line-Up. So far we’ve covered Sunday night and Monday night’s line-ups for the major networks. Keep reading to see what we’re going to be watching on Tuesday’s.

ABC

  • Dancing with the Stars: Results at 8:00 pm will premier on September 25th.
  • Happy Endings at 9:00 pm will premier its third season with an episode titled “Cazsh Dummy Spillionaires” on October 23rd.
  • Don’t Trust the B_ _ _ _ in Apartment 23 at 9:30 pm will premier its second season with an episode titled “A Reunion…” on October 23rd.
  • Private Practice at 10:00 pm will premier its sixth season with an episode titled “Aftershock” on September 25th.

CBS

  • NCIS at 8:00 pm will premier its tenth season on September 25th.
  • NCIS: Los Angeles at 9:00 pm will premier its fourth season with an episode titled “Endgame” on September 25th.
  • Vegas at 10:00 pm will premier its pilot episode titled “Vegas” on September 25th.

FOX

  • Raising Hope at 8:00 pm will premier its third season on October 2nd.
  • Ben and Kate at 8:30 pm will premier its “Pilot” episode on September 25th.
  • New Girl at 9:00 pm will premier its second season on September 25th.
  • The Mindy Project at 9:30 pm will premier its “Pilot” episode on September 25th.

The CW

  • Hart of Dixie at 8:00 pm will premier its second season on October 2nd.
  • Emily Owens M.D. at 9:00 pm will premier its “Pilot” episode on October 16th.

NBC

  • The Voice: Results at 8:00 pm will premier on September 11th.
  • Go On at 9:00 pm will premier its “Pilot” episode on September 11th.
  • The New Normal at 9:30 pm will premier its “Pilot” episode on September 11th.
  • Parenthood at 10:00 pm will premier its fourth season with an episode titled “Family Portrait” on September 11th.

Notes

* Due to the fact that Raising Hope will not be airing its new season at the same time as the other FOX shows, New Girl will have two brand new episodes. However, how these will air will depend on your cable provider so be sure to check that out.

* As always times are in EST so check your times to make sure you catch the shows if you are not setting them up to DVR beforehand.

* Lastly, all times and dates are from the networks and are subject to change on their whims.

About the Shows
Don’t Trust the B _ _ _ _ _ in Apartment 23 || I loved the first episode of this series. When I say loved, well that’s just not a strong enough word for it. I loved the character of Chloe, James Van Der Beek was awesomesauce, and even if Dreama Walker as June was a tad bit annoying I’ve seen worse so she was at least livable. Then I watched the second episode everything changed. The little bit of chemistry that was there between Krysten and Dreama was gone and while James was still awesomesauce he just wasn’t enough to hold my attention. By the fourth episode of the first season I deleted it off the DVR’s “To Record” list and moved on. I don’t think the second season is going to be any better, sadly.

Private Practice || Kate Walsh, Kate Walsh, what are we going to do with you? Earlier this year Kate announced that the sixth season of Private Practice was going to be her last. While I think that everyone deserves to make their own choices when it comes to their careers the fact that she is leaving Private Practice this season and one of the first projects she does afterwards is Scary Movie 5. I just don’t get her thinking in this, but hey I was never a Scary Movie fan (don’t confuse that with the fact that I do LOVE scary movies.) However the bigger issue with this is, “where does that leave Private Practice?”

Vegas || According to IMDB Vegas is a show about a “rodeo cowboy who becomes sheriff.” Now I do not think that this in paticular will make for exciting television. That being said Vegas will star Dennis Quaid, Carrie-Anne Moss, and Michael Chiklis which I feel WILL make for exciting television. I’m excited to see where this one goes.

Emily Owens M.D. || Wow is it just me or all channels now trying to cash in on that Grey’s Anatomy fame? Emily Owens M.D. seems to be doing this but with a more comedic approach. This series will actually liken working at a hospital to being back in high school.

Go On || John Cho AND Matthew Perry? Together? Umm yes please. I have loved Matthew Perry since watching Friends and I cringe every time he signs onto a project that you just KNOW is setting sail for fail and port is already within view. I’m hoping that these two will work well together and we’ll wind up with a long lasting series.
